Clarithromycin: What It Is, How It Works, and What You Need to Know

When you’re dealing with a stubborn infection, your doctor might reach for clarithromycin, a macrolide antibiotic that stops bacteria from growing by blocking protein production. Also known as Biaxin, it’s one of the most prescribed antibiotics for respiratory and skin infections, and even for stomach ulcers caused by H. pylori. Unlike some broad-spectrum drugs, clarithromycin targets specific bacteria without wiping out everything in your gut—though it still can cause digestive upset. It’s not a cure-all, but when used right, it’s a powerful tool.

Clarithromycin is often paired with other drugs, especially for treating H. pylori, a bacteria that causes peptic ulcers and chronic stomach inflammation. You’ll usually see it combined with proton pump inhibitors and amoxicillin in a three-drug regimen. For lung infections like pneumonia or bronchitis, it’s chosen because it penetrates lung tissue well. It’s also used for skin infections like cellulitis, and sometimes for ear infections in kids when other antibiotics fail. But it’s not for every bug—viruses don’t respond to it, and some bacteria have grown resistant over time.

Side effects are common but usually mild: nausea, diarrhea, bad taste in the mouth, or stomach cramps. More serious reactions—like liver problems or irregular heartbeat—are rare but real, especially if you’re taking other meds. That’s why it’s critical to tell your doctor about everything you’re on, including heart medications, blood thinners, or even St. John’s wort. The macrolide class, which includes azithromycin and erythromycin shares similar risks, so if you’ve had a bad reaction to one, you might react to others too.

Clarithromycin isn’t something you take casually. Even if you feel better after a few days, finishing the full course matters—stopping early lets surviving bacteria become stronger. It’s also not safe for everyone: people with liver disease, certain heart rhythm issues, or a history of allergic reactions to similar antibiotics need alternatives. And while it’s sometimes used off-label, like for Lyme disease or certain immune conditions, those uses aren’t backed by strong evidence.
